Duplicate facsimile of the inscription and general appearance of the plate of copper belonging to the coffin of King Robert the Bruce, c 1914
Facsimile of the inscription and general appearance of the plate of copper belonging to the coffin of King Robert the Bruce, whose remains were deposited in Dunfermline in the year 1329 and found on opening his grave 5th November 1819. The original plate was deposited with the Society of Antiquaries of Scotland by order of the Right Honble The Barons of Exchequer.
